Ebook file size??! 1138MB
Hi,
Why are ebook file sizes a) so huge, and b) so different from each other? I have a novel on my Kindle that is 1138MB. Some others are around 200MB. Many of my other books are around 200KB. Why the size discrepancy, and can I make them smaller somehow, without losing quality? I was told I would get 1000s of books on this Kindle Paperwhite Signature (32GB), but I have put 180 books on there and almost 10GB is used already. The files were mostly epub and I converted to MOBI automatically in Calibre when I sent to device. They were close to the same size before the conversion to MOBI so I do not think the conversion is the issue. In a couple of cases the huge files were textbooks (which I deleted) but the large files that remain are fairly regular books. tks |

ePubs are just zip files by another name, so you can unzip a renamed copy and find out what's making the book files so big. For example, the most recently bought book I have is Dean Koontz's The Bad Weather Friend. A novel of around 330 pages in paperback. The AZW3 download from Amazon is 1.1MB, the converted ePub is 933KB. Expanding the ePub gives a 1.6MB folder, of which 733KB is text, 556 KB is images, 188KB is fonts and 122KB is the cover image. You can examine your books similarly. |

eBooks from Penguin Random House have a next reads HTML It uses a graphic image and 2 or 3 embedded fonts. None of this is needed and can all be removed.
Also, embedded fonts can make eBooks larger. You can use Polish Books to subset the fonts so they are smaller. |

And if you don't care about the fonts at all, hit the 'Convert Books' button, go to 'Look & feel > Styling', select the Fonts box, and the conversion will remove all fonts and CSS references to those fonts. |
